While Bethesda did tease that sales for Eternal were the best yet in the series, doubling what Doom 2016 had made, we havent actually known the proper number until now.
Heading on over to LinkedIn, we can see the profile of a former id Software developer who claims that Doom Eternal ending up making $450 million dollars in just nine months. Bear in mind, those numbers werent achieved in a vacuum; you dont need me to tell you that last year we faced the full might of a global pandemic (which is still going on, wear your damn mask) so Eternal making that kind of cash in those circumstances is wildly impressive. Those kinds of numbers must mean that Bethesda will be banging on ids door, demanding a third game. At least, we hope thats the case.
